More free music for you~! Yep. There's lots of free music out there, and a lot of it is pretty darn good even! ;)

Check out the Free Music Archive for a massive library of free music. Now, a lot of that music isn't totally free as in BSD free, but it's free to listen to at least. A lot is Creative Commons licensed.

Now, not all music is for everyone, but if you like electronic stuff, you may well like "Get Twisted". It's CC 2.0 (Attribution-Noncommercial Share Alike) licensed. So, if you're not using it commercially, and you provide attribution and allow people to share what you create there, then you're good to go. And, Get Twisted is some pretty wicked cool stuff to boot!
